man who is colorblind marries a woman who has normal color vision and is not a carrier of color blindness. If this couple has a son, what are the chances he will be colorblind? Could they have a colorblind daughter? HTML EditorKeyboard Shortcuts

Answer:

Each of their sons has around a 0% chance for being color blind.

they will have normal girls but they will be carriers

Step-by-step explanation:

Since the man is colour blind and he donates the X- Chromosome that is the carrier to the woman, they will give birth to a daughter who is a carrier but not color blind. If the man donates the Y chromosome, then they will give birth to a normal male child who is not color blind neither is he a carrier
